WON TON WRAPPERS | |
4 c. flour 1 tsp. salt 2 eggs, beaten 1 c. cold water Sift flour and salt into a large bowl, add eggs and water. Mix until ingredients can be gathered into a ball. Knead just enough to make dough smooth but still soft. Do not over knead, or dough will become stiff. Divide into 4 equal balls and roll out each ball on a lightly floured surface into a square 14 inches by 1/16 inch thick. Cut with a sharp knife into 3 1/2 inch squares. Cover with a damp cloth if dough must sit a while. COMMENTARY: Rolling the dough between plastic wraps simplifies the task and makes handling the thin sheets easier. Do this before cutting the sheets into squares. |
